If you have your Gmail ID and password you can install the free app 
AndroidLost on your phone from another internet connected device's web browser. Then you can:
* read sent and received SMS messages
* wipe phone
* lock phone
* erase SD card
* locate by GPS or network
* start alarm with flashing screen
* send SMS from web page
* message popup
* forward calls
* remote install
* phone status: battery, imei, etc.
* remote SMS alarm
* remote SMS lock and unlock
* remote SMS erase SD card
* remote SMS wipe phone
* remote SMS APN control
* start/stop GPS
* start/stop WIFI
* hide from launcher
* email when SIM card is changed
* get call list
* take picture with front camera
* take picture with rear camera
* make your phone speak with text-to-speech
* SMS message command
* SMS speak command
* lock timeout
* restore settings on boot
* record sound from microphone
* start and stop data connection from SMS
* start and stop WIFI connection from SMS
* content browser prototype
before you take it to the Service people where you bought it for a basic reset. You don't want them to have access to your data either, do you? So better wipe it all before you hand it over.
Of course you have a good, recent backup data set of the phone stored somewhere close so that you can restore that to the phone after its reset, don't you?